Salerno: The Gateway to the Amalfi Coast

Salerno, often referred to as the "Gateway to the Amalfi Coast," is a picturesque coastal city located in southern Italy. Nestled on the Tyrrhenian Sea, Salerno boasts a unique blend of history, culture, and natural beauty that promises a memorable travel experience.

### History and Culture

Salerno's history dates back to ancient times when it was a thriving Roman settlement. The city's rich past is reflected in its historical architecture, such as the Salerno Cathedral, a stunning example of Norman architecture. While exploring the city, you can also visit the Salerno Medical School, one of the oldest medical institutions in the world, dating back to the 9th century.

Paestum: Ancient Wonders

Just a short drive from Salerno lies the ancient city of Paestum. This archaeological wonder is a treasure trove of ancient Greek and Roman ruins.

### Historical Marvels

Paestum is renowned for its remarkably preserved Greek temples, including the Temple of Hera, the Temple of Athena, and the Temple of Neptune. These structures, dating back to the 6th century BC, stand as a testament to the city's rich history and architectural prowess.

### Paestum Archaeological Museum

Don't forget to visit the Paestum Archaeological Museum, where you can explore an extensive collection of artifacts from the ancient city. It's a fascinating journey through the daily life and culture of Paestum's past inhabitants.

Amalfi: The Jewel of the Amalfi Coast

Amalfi, the crown jewel of the Amalfi Coast, is a place of timeless beauty, vibrant culture, and world-class cuisine.

### Amalfi Cathedral

The Amalfi Cathedral, dedicated to St. Andrew, is a masterpiece of medieval Italian architecture. Its stunning façade and intricate mosaics are a testament to the city's artistic heritage.
